Honeymoon Suite is the debut album by Canadian rock band Honeymoon Suite, released in 1984 on Warner Bros. Records. In 1990 it was certified Triple Platinum in Canada (in excess of 300,000 copies sold).[1] All four singles - "New Girl Now", "Burning in Love", "Wave Babies" and "Stay in the Light" - were also certified Gold in Canada.

Singles[edit]

The following singles (together with promotional videos) were released from the album:

# Title Release Date CAN US
1 "New Girl Now" June 15, 1984 23 57
2 "Burning in Love" Oct. 5, 1984 75 -
3 "Stay in the Light" Feb. 8, 1985 44 -
4 "Wave Babies" June 17, 1985 59 -

Personnel[edit]

  • Derry Grehan - lead guitar, vocals
  • Johnnie Dee - lead vocals, guitar
  • Brian Brackstone - bass guitar (courtesy of Attic Records)
  • Ray Coburn - keyboards, vocals
  • Dave Betts - drums

Band member Gary Lalonde (bass guitar, vocals) is shown in the photograph of the band on the back cover.
